About Littlelives
LittleLives is an EdTech company made up of preschool-friendly advocates. The human connection is at the heart of everything we do β it drives the technologies we create, to make an impact on every aspect of school. Our holistic school management system was built to simplify the tedious and complex administrative processes of preschools. LittleLives is accredited by the Ministry of Education, Singapore (MOE), Early Childhood Development Agency (ECDA) and has been ranked Top Preschool Software by Association for Early Childhood Educators (Singapore) β AECES. As a Software As A Service (SAAS), LittleLives holds a strong presence in over 1000 schools in Singapore, Malaysia, China, Vietnam and Cambodia.
